Transaction 81e8f714c93d89ffda6d4f791a29134eb1944061fa31f991816845a8c15253ce
1 Input
1 Output
-
81e8f714c93d89ffda6d4f791a29134eb1944061fa31f991816845a8c15253ce:0
- value
- 54272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3428f6557e80bbac059068373442bf04750ae081 OP_EQUAL
- address
- 36Sp8dE8FwhapKxY3uR5Jy6iLYwWqbyXDw